Who We Are Looking For
We are looking for a collaborative leader and creative individual to join the digital marketing team as a lead UX designer. In this position, you will guide other UX professionals and digital product stakeholders through each stage of the UX Design Process and is accountable for establishing standards and driving execution of design deliverables and for the ultimate outcomes of those deliverables.
What You Will Do as USANA's Lead UX Designer
- Define the UX vision for mobile app touchpoints within and work with other UX and Digital Product professionals to ensure that project work consistently advances that vision
- Plan, prioritize, and schedule all UX project work within the mobile app domain
- Coordinate with stakeholders across domains to establish and maintain a seamless user experience across touchpoints and channels
- Generate or manage the generation of deliverables for all mobile app UX project work
- Work directly with USANA sellers, Customers, and Stakeholders to inform and validate project requirements
- Synthesize customer insights and align them to business objectives
Background and Skills You Will Need
- Bachelor's Degree in UX Design, Interaction Design, Human Computer Interaction, or other evidence of exceptional design knowledge and experience
- 3-5 years' work experience creating, defining, and advocating for world-class experiencesin native mobile environments
- Experience drafting and maintaining a strategic workload roadmap
- Experience working in an Agile Design and Development environment and implementing experience strategy across development sprint
- Well-versed in branding, marketing, development, and business strategy and able to communicate and work with stakeholders in these and other fields across the company, including executives
